Hey People :3 .. I have an google play and a samsung galaxy s4 octa core version ^_^

When I download games ,, its 230mb/500mb .. then suddenly I cancel it .. so where is the 230mb goes ? are they will be delete automatically ?? because when I press install again ,, google play continue download it from 230mb .. so if i never want to download it back ,, are the 230mb will be delete automatically ??

The new download method from Google now has its own Zip file type of package which contains the games data called an obb file. When you download these games it will download the obb file, then switch to the Apk. When both are downloaded then Android will install the package.

If the download you wanted to cancel has downloaded the obb file completely, the obb file in a containing folder will remain (Untill deleted manually or by un-installing the application) in /storage/Sdcard/Android/obb/"Game data here". If resume the download again Google will check and see you have the data already and download just the remaining Apk.

If the download you wanted to cancel has NOT downloaded the obb file completly, the obb will be half a temporary file and the device will delete it automatically after a period of time or when a total loss of connection to Google servers occurs. If resume in this case, the games data (Obb file) and Apk will all have to be downloaded again from scratch.

So basically the answer to your question is located in /Storage/Sdcard/Android/Obb/Smile Hope this helps.
